Slovenia - Import of Expanded Metal of Iron or Non-Alloy Steel
Since 2014, Slovenia Import of Expanded Metal of Iron or Non-Alloy Steel jumped by 17.4%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 49 comparing other countries in Import of Expanded Metal of Iron or Non-Alloy Steel with $1,130,524.74. Slovenia is overtaken by Uruguay, which was number 48 at $1,168,146.6 and is followed by Mali at $1,058,682.38. United States ranked the highest with $45,161,157.25 in 2019, that is -2.5% versus 2018. France, Germany and Portugal resp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Iran recorded the best 5 years average growth at +301.9% per year, while Benin recorded the worst performance at -74% per year.
